F1 Star Faces Imola Grand Prix Grid Plunge After FIA Rule Violation

Formula One F1 - Emilia Romagna Grand Prix - Autodromo Enzo e Dino Ferrari, Imola, Italy - May 17, 2025 Alpine's Franco Colapinto during practice REUTERS/Florion Goga

F1 Sensation: Star Driver Faces Imminent GRID DROP at Imola Grand Prix

A major upheaval looms over the Formula 1 circuit as one of its star drivers is on the brink of a grid penalty at the upcoming Imola Grand Prix. The FIA has dropped a bombshell by revealing that stewards are currently investigating a driver for a serious breach. The driver in question, Franco Colapinto of Alpine, was released from the garage prematurely, violating regulations by entering the pit lane before receiving official clearance. As a result, a ‘slam-dunk’ grid penalty is now imminent for the driver due to this critical error.

In a chaotic turn of events at Imola, Lewis Hamilton faced unexpected challenges, adding to the drama of the unfolding F1 season. The stewards wasted no time in confirming that an investigation into Colapinto’s Q1 incident will be conducted post-qualifying. This comes in light of an alleged violation of Article 12.2.1 i) of the International Sporting Code and failure to comply with the race director’s event note. While an official verdict is still pending, the FIA’s past actions in similar cases suggest that a one-place grid drop is highly likely for the Argentine driver.

Colapinto’s already turbulent return to F1 with Alpine took a turn for the worse during his first qualifying session at Imola. A crash in the closing stages of Q1 led to a second red flag, disrupting the flow of the session. Despite walking away unscathed, the driver’s car suffered significant damage after hitting the barrier at Tamburello following a spin. Despite managing to secure a P15 finish and advance to Q2, Colapinto now faces the prospect of starting Sunday’s race from 16th place due to the impending grid penalty.

This setback in Imola marks a challenging chapter in Colapinto’s F1 journey, especially after stepping in as Jack Doohan’s replacement at Alpine. The anticipation builds as the FIA’s verdict on Colapinto’s penalty is awaited, promising yet another twist in the thrilling world of Formula 1.
